Legends of Wood and Silk (China) by Qiyuan Lu
Having existed for over two thousand years, the Guqin is one of China's most original string instruments. In the year 2019, the 82-year-old Guqin master, Wong Duo, reluctantly performed in his hometown of Suzhou, where his lifelong dedication to the revival of traditional silk string style has made him a minority among the predominant steel string players. To support him, Li Guo, Wong's youngest disciple whose playing strongly echoes that of her master's, invited Wong to give a truly authentic Guqin concert in the modern cosmopolitan of Shenzhen, in order to reach a larger and more diverse audience.

One hand the other (Germany) by Lenna Fichter, Janis Westphal
Martina is a handicapped person. In order to be able to live her everyday life in her own home, she requires personal assistance. When Sandra starts working for her, the two of them carefully approach each other. In the extreme intimacy between the tenderness of the gestures, it is also the heaviness of the situation that emerges. It is a fragile dance between being near and being distant, that demands a lot from both of them.

Wayward (United Kingdom) by Ross Casswell
Wayward is a feature documentary charting one man's ambition to restore and motor 'his wreck of a boat' from London to Ireland to reunite with his family. All plans soon take a back seat as struggles with alcoholism, spiralling mental health and mounting debt threatens to hamper all progress. Can he find the personal resolve to turn it around before it all closes in?

Mitayo (Peru) by Marco Alvarado
Mitayo is the Amazonian word that describes the time of fishing in a hamlet called Aguanomuyuna in the Chazuta district in the city of Tarapoto of the San Martín Region in the jungle of Peru. The Shapiama Inuma family invites us to "mitayar"."
